Description
"A suspenseful novel involving a mystery writer whose family was devastated when she was sixteen when her infant brother disappeared without a trace. Decades later a young detective from London stumbles upon the ruins of the family's lakeside estate in Cornwall and begins digging into the unsolved case"--
